10:33Now PlayingJudge Genece Brinkley strikes again.According to 76ers owner Michael Rubin, a Pennsylvania judge has denied rapper Meek Mill’s probation request to travel with the team out of the country as they face the Raptors for Games 1 and 2 of the Eastern Conference semifinals.
Rubin posted on Instagram that the 76ers had filed for preliminary approval with probation officials, a request that was granted but then struck down by Common Pleas Court Judge Genece Brinkley, according to the owner. Do you think meek mill friend Micheal Rubin is going over broad?
Mill, a Philadelphia native whose music has become a soundtrack for the city’s sports franchises, was released from prison a year ago after serving a five-month sentence for violating the terms of his probation stemming from a gun and drug conviction in 2008.
